[Imaging of Lemierre in children and young adults].

Praxis 2013 December 12
PURPOSE: The aim of this study is to describe the role of imaging in the medical care of Lemierre Syndrome and to describe its US, CT and MRI features.

PATIENTS AND METHODS: Files of patients diagnosed with Lemierre Syndrome between 2005 and 2011 at CHUV hospital have been analysed retrospectively to define its imaging semiology.

RESULTS: IJV thrombosis was demonstrated by US, CT and MRI. Septic pulmonary emboli were detected by CT. Complications of the Lemierre Syndrome were depicted by MR and CT.

CONCLUSION: US, CT or MR evidence of IJV thrombosis and chest CT suggestive of septic emboli, should lead the physician to diagnose Lemierre Syndrome, which in case of insufficient therapy can lead to death.
